A Earth Without the Luna
Imagine a planet where Earth spins without its familiar companion. Oceanic shifts would be dramatically altered, eliminating the rhythmic rise and ebb that shapes coastal environments . The rotational inclination of Earth would probably experience significant instability over geological timescales, leading to harsh weather changes and conceivably rendering many regions unsuitable for life . Days might be slightly shorter, and the want of the Moon's pull would also affect the Earth’s internal behavior, potentially triggering frequent volcanic activity and shifting the Earth’s crust .
